 Riverside To Honor First Responders on 9/11
On September 11, the City of Riverside, and its private sector, educational, and civic partners, will host its first citywide Day of Service to honor its first responders and those that lost their lives in the terrorist attacks of September 11, 2001.
This event will feature activiteis from one end of Riverside to the other, starting off with a fundraising breakfast and ending with a closing ceremony, at 6:00 p.m. at La Sierra University.
One of the flagship events will be a recognition ceremony, scheduled to take place outside of City Hall at 9:11 a.m.
Across the city there will also be blood banks, CPR demonstrations, and other events.

The Mission Belle C-17 Airplane Celebrates "The Spirit of Riverside"
On August 11, 2015, I was honored to attend a dedication ceremony with Colonel Russell A. Muncy, at March Air Reserve Base.
During the ceremony, we unveiled the new nose art for the C-17 Globemaster III, a welcome addition to March Air Force Base. The nose art was designed in tribute to Riverside's long and rich history and the role our city has played in the larger region.
